About Rose Cottage

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

Rose Cottage is a detached house in Kirton, Boston, Boston (PE20 1LZ). It has a recorded floor area of 191 m² (around 2056 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(November 2016) shows an E (score 52),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 85), a 3-band jump. Main heating runs on electricity.

At 191 m² the property is well over the postcode median (79 m² across 9 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Across 2019–2019, sale prices on this property compounded at 24.7%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£323,000 is 33.6% above the 2019 sale price. Most recent transfer: November 2019 at £241,840.
